Q: Is 1,705,364 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 1,705,364 is not a prime number.

Why is 1,705,364 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 1705364 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 19 38 76 361 722 1,181 1,444 2,362 4,724 22,439 44,878 89,756 426,341 852,682 and 1,705,364, with no remainder.

Since 1,705,364 cannot be divided by just 1 and 1,705,364, it is not a prime number.
